Answer :

Here a noun in it's comparative degree should be used because - comparative degree is used to indicate that one subject is better than the other subject / subjects .

Since Raghav is being called the more wise when compared with another boy , a comparative degree should be used here .

The comparative degree is WISER .

Hence , this sentence in it's correct form will be written as :

Raghav is the wiser of the two boys .
